[0001] This application relates to the field of communication technology, and in particular to an anomaly detection method, apparatus, device, and storage medium. Background Technology

[0002] As buildings become increasingly dense and taller in cities, coupled with fully enclosed exterior finishes, the shielding, attenuation, and interference of radio signals increase, resulting in poor signal quality indoors. A common solution to this problem is to install indoor distribution systems within buildings.

[0003] Indoor distribution systems utilize indoor antenna distribution systems to evenly distribute base station signals throughout a building, ensuring ideal signal coverage in every area and improving the mobile communication environment within the building. However, due to the large number of network elements connected to the indoor distribution system, such as indoor antennas and passive devices, and the lack of effective monitoring methods for these elements, when a fault occurs in a local area, the network management platform and performance platform cannot detect it in a timely manner, thus failing to quickly eliminate potential network risks. [0049] If the first historical time period is from June 25, 2022 to September 27, 2022, the cell to be detected is cell A, and the target indicator is traffic volume, then the anomaly detection device queries the network management platform for the daily traffic volume indicator data of cell A during the period from June 25, 2022 to September 27, 2022, thereby obtaining the historical indicator data of the cell to be detected.

[0050] It should be noted that the first historical time period can be preset in the anomaly detection device by the communication system's maintenance personnel. A longer first historical time period results in more accurate anomaly values ​​determined based on the indicator data within that period, but also increases the computational load. Conversely, a shorter first historical time period reduces the accuracy of anomaly values ​​but decreases the computational load. Generally, the first historical time period can be set to 30-90 days; this embodiment does not impose a specific limitation on this.

[0052] S202. The anomaly detection device determines the abnormal values ​​of the target indicator based on the historical indicator data of the cell to be detected.

[0053] Outliers include upper and lower limits.

[0054] In some embodiments, after acquiring historical indicator data of the cell to be detected, the anomaly detection device determines the maximum and minimum values ​​in the historical indicator data, and determines the maximum value as the upper limit of anomalies and the minimum value as the lower limit of anomalies, thereby obtaining the anomaly value corresponding to the target indicator.

[0055] For example, if the sampling point quantity index of the cell to be tested includes 150, 120, 115, 128, 80, and 178, the anomaly detection device determines the upper limit of the anomaly for the sampling point quantity index to be 178 and the lower limit to be 80. If the traffic volume index of the cell to be tested includes 300, 250, 50, 225, 170, and 90, the anomaly detection device determines the upper limit of the anomaly for the traffic volume index to be 300 and the lower limit to be 50. If the weak coverage ratio index of the cell to be tested includes 8%, 7%, 9%, 3%, 15%, and 11%, the anomaly detection device determines the upper limit of the anomaly for the weak coverage ratio index to be 15% and the lower limit to be 3%.

[0056] In some embodiments, to avoid the anomaly detection device being affected by the abnormal data in the historical indicator data when determining the anomaly value, the method for the anomaly detection device to determine the anomaly value may also be: the anomaly detection device determines the maximum value and minimum value in the historical indicator data of the target indicator, and determines the value obtained by subtracting a first preset value from the maximum value as the upper limit of the anomaly, and determines the value obtained by adding a second preset value to the minimum value as the lower limit of the anomaly, thereby obtaining the anomaly value corresponding to the target indicator.

[0057] For example, based on the historical data of each target indicator in the above examples, if the first preset value for the number of sampling points indicator is 20 and the second preset value is 15, then the anomaly detection device determines that the upper limit of the anomaly for the number of sampling points indicator is 158 and the lower limit of the anomaly is 95. If the first preset value for the traffic volume indicator is 40 and the second preset value is 25, then the anomaly detection device determines that the upper limit of the anomaly for the traffic volume indicator is 260 and the lower limit of the anomaly is 75. If the first preset value for the weak coverage ratio indicator is 3% and the second preset value is 2%, then the anomaly detection device determines that the upper limit of the anomaly for the weak coverage ratio indicator is 12% and the lower limit of the anomaly is 5%.

[0065] The second historical time period can be preset in the anomaly detection device by the operation and maintenance personnel of the communication system. Generally, the first historical time period can be set to 3-7 days. This application embodiment does not make a specific limitation on this.

[0066] In some embodiments, if the second historical time period falls during a holiday, the anomaly detection device adds one day to the preset number of days in the second historical time period to avoid the impact of holiday fluctuations when determining anomaly indicators, thus ensuring the reliability of the anomaly cell determination in this application embodiment.

[0067] For example, if the second historical time period is 3 days and covers the May Day holiday, then the second historical time period is further updated to 4 days the day before the May Day holiday.

[0082] S301, The anomaly detection device acquires the daily indicator data of the target indicator of the cell to be detected within the first historical time period.

[0083] It should be noted that the specific implementation method of the anomaly detection device acquiring the daily indicator data of the target indicator of the cell under test within the first historical time period can be referred to the description of step S201 in the above embodiment of this application, and will not be repeated here.

[0084] S302, The anomaly detection device determines the lower quartile and upper quartile of the daily indicator data of the target indicator.

[0085] As one possible implementation, the anomaly detection device sorts the daily indicator data of the target indicator obtained in step S301 to obtain indicator data sorted from smallest to largest. Further, the anomaly detection device calculates the lower quartile and upper quartile from the sorted indicator data.

[0086] For example, let the lower quartile be Q1 and the upper quartile be Q3. If the index data sorted from smallest to largest are x1, x2, ..., x... n The anomaly detection device then determines the position of Q1 as follows: The position of Q3 is Furthermore, the anomaly detection device detects x1, x2, ..., x n In the middle, determine For Q1, determine For Q3.

[0087] S303. The anomaly detection device determines the upper and lower limits of anomalies for the target indicator based on the lower and upper quartiles.

[0088] As one possible implementation, the anomaly detection device determines the interquartile range of historical indicator data based on the lower quartile and upper quartile determined in step S302. Further, the anomaly detection device determines the lower limit of anomalies based on the lower quartile and the interquartile range, and determines the upper limit of anomalies based on the upper quartile and the interquartile range.

[0089] Specifically, the anomaly detection device can determine the lower limit and upper limit of anomalies according to the following formula.

[0090] IQR = Q3 - Q1

[0091] G1=Q1-k*IQR

[0092] G2=Q3+k*IQR

[0093] Where IQR is the interquartile range, Q3 is the upper quartile, Q1 is the lower quartile, G1 is the lower limit of anomalies, k is the interquartile range coefficient (exemplarily 1.5), and G2 is the upper limit of anomalies. For example, the upper and lower limits of anomalies determined by the anomaly detection device are as follows: Figure 5 As shown, when the indicator data exceeds the upper or lower limit of the abnormal value, the indicator data is identified as an abnormal value.

[0094] In some embodiments, if it is determined that the lower limit of outliers is negative, and the indicator data based on each target indicator cannot be negative, then the lower limit of outliers is determined to be 0.

[0095] Understandably, in the anomaly detection method provided in this application embodiment, the anomaly detection device uses a box plot algorithm to determine the upper and lower limits of the target indicator based on historical indicator data, so as to detect the target indicator data of the cell to be detected and determine whether the cell to be detected is an abnormal cell.

[0106] In some embodiments, the anomaly detection method provided in this application was used in a practical application. The anomaly detection device performed anomaly detection on a cell under an indoor distribution system for 3 months and obtained the data shown in Table 2 below.

[0107] Table 2: Community Anomaly Detection Table

[0108] month Number of abnormal cells Verify and confirm the number of faulty cells accuracy June 35 25 71.4% July 26 20 76.9% August 32 24 75.0%

[0109] As can be seen from the table above, the anomaly detection method provided in this application embodiment can achieve an accuracy of over 70% in detecting abnormal cells, demonstrating high reliability.
